David Genat’s Career Highlights
David Genat’s career took off in the early 2000s when he became one of Australia’s top male models. His sharp looks and charisma landed him international modeling contracts, leading him to work with some of the biggest brands in the world.
However, his breakthrough in mainstream entertainment came in 2019 when he competed in Australian Survivor: Champions vs. Contenders. Although he didn’t win, he made a lasting impact with his strategic gameplay. He returned in 2020 for Australian Survivor: All Stars and secured the title, solidifying his reputation as one of the best players in the franchise’s history.
After his reality TV success, he ventured into acting, appearing in Australian dramas and working on several entertainment projects.
